没有MapToStoredProcedures
在 EF Core 中,这是一个遗憾,因为它允许Add
隐藏是否使用存储过程的方法。
我查看了 EF Core 3.1 和 5,但找不到推荐的替代品。因此,如果我有下面的代码,如何/在哪里设置和调用插入存储过程或选择存储过程?
public class DatabaseModel : DbContext
{
public virtual DbSet<Office> Offices { get; set; }
public DatabaseModel(DbContextOptions<DatabaseModel> options) : base(options)
{ }
protected override void OnModelCreating(ModelBuilder modelBuilder) {}
}
谢谢你的帮助。
MapToStoredProcedures
EF CORE 不支持。
您可以执行存储过程FromSqlRaw
Method.
var result = ctx.ParameterDetails.FromSqlRaw("EXEC dbo.get_nextparam @UserId={0}", userId).ToList();
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)